Chookasked
How do I replace cutting plate?
2 answers
No idea.
It's actually a drum with teeth against a plate crush/cutting. Works best on dryer stuff. The teeth wear off, and you turn a screw to to get it close again.
If you have a plate, then you have another type of machine that has two cutting blades. If you look inside the chute and see a big gear that crushes the branches and doesn't cut them, then you adjust the clearance using an allen screw on the side. You turn it clockwise until you hear a grinding noise then back it off about a quarter turn.

Would the Ozito Silent Shredder be suitable for chopping up dry straw into something finer for the garden?
4 answers
I've not used the Ozito Silent Shredder for mulching straw, so I am only expressing an opinion based on my findings. What I do know is, it shreds small diameter vines well enough, providing the material is aged and DRY. The larger the vine diameter, the better shredding results. I adjusted the blade marginally closer to the manufactures recommended distance to achieve a good result. The adjustment is very simple and takes only seconds to achieve. After each use, and before I stow the shredder away, I give the blade a quick squirt of WD40 while its running to limit corrosion and help maintain an "edge".
I agree with 'Greener Thumb'. The shredder does not do much for leaves, but the straw stalks should be OK.
It's more a crusher than a shredder. A single slow spinning cog grabs the branches and crushes them against a metal blade. Dry dead Palm leaves for example go through largely intact at the other end, as does any green branches and leaves. So I'd say the same would happen to Straw. This thing crushers whatever you insert, into chips but only if it's dry material and not palms. It does not mulch as the cog doesn't rotate fast enough. Makes about the same amount of noise as a washing machine. Very easy to use.

Gazzaasked
I can't get the shredder to restart after the motor shut off due to a jam (which I have removed). The manual says there's a motorprotection circuit and to simply unplug, allow time for the motor to cool, then replug, press the reset button and attempt to start as normal. However this does not work. The machine remains completely unresponsive. Has anyone else had this issue? I'd appreciate any ideas for a fix...
2 answers
I have not had this problem, so I cannot answer you from direct experience. However, a friend with a Silent Shredder had a problem with what he believed to be faulty switches, and returned the machine under warrantee.
Thanks Dejayajay. Mine is well out of warrantee... but all's well that ends well... after leaving it overnight, I tried the reset button again, and it worked! Manual says let it cool for "at least 5 min"... looks like it needs a lot more time than that.
